    SUMMARY: With the draft just over a week away, the Titans will continue with their strategy of taking the best player available with pick #30 and #62. "If you have a chance to get a player that's special … it's more important to get a difference maker on your team than to get depth at a position," GM Mike Reinfeldt said. He said a prime example of this was last season when the Titans selected Chris Johnson. "He was a much better, much higher grade than the players we had on the board, at the positions we thought we had needs at," Reinfeldt said. CBs Vontae Davis of Illinois and Darius Butler of Connecticut are the latest mock draft favorites for the Titans to select with the 30th pick. WRs Percy Harvin of Florida and Hakeem Nicks of North Carolina have also been mentioned as possibilities.
